Transaction 20687b970facdf79b869c998217d074c70760443eeaccebb8dfd4950163396b7

1 Input
2 Outputs
  • 20687b970facdf79b869c998217d074c70760443eeaccebb8dfd4950163396b7:0
  • value  4268808
    address  1Eb9NK2ozTQbDG2NebMFpbi7EsXaZKFkto
  • 20687b970facdf79b869c998217d074c70760443eeaccebb8dfd4950163396b7:1
  • value  74481984
    address  3BPXeSeSgG3iuLbHEfzRrnUhbQBxdgHYeY